Q: Is 509,228 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 509,228 is not a prime number.

Why is 509,228 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 509228 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 61 122 244 2,087 4,174 8,348 127,307 254,614 and 509,228, with no remainder.

Since 509,228 cannot be divided by just 1 and 509,228, it is not a prime number.
